L
lfhelper
Jungspund
Also
1. Es gibt keinen reinen Unix-Kernel.
Das ist ja der wesentliche Unterschied zw. klassischen Unices und Linux.
Bei Linux kannste den Kernel, die C-Library (meistens glibc) und das Userland
auswechseln und kombinieren wie deine Garderobe.*
* ich übertreibe ein wenig. Die Kernel-Module müssen natürlich immer zum Kernel passen und manche Programme müssten neukompiliert werden gegen neue Kernel-sourcen oder glibc, um einwandfrei weiterzufunktionieren.
Klassische Unix Betriebssysteme bieten diesen "Luxus" nicht, den Kernel vom Rest des Systems so schön trennen zu können, wie es Linux kann.
2. Jedes Open-Source Unix/BSD hat seine kompletten Quellen online,
du musst dich nur auf den jeweiligen Seiten umgucken.
OFFTOPIC:
3. Also von unixboard-Benutzern hätte ich mehr und bessere Antworten auf diese Frage erwartet.
PS: Ich bin Linux-Spezialist, von BSDs/Unixen weiss ich nur wenig und bin trotzdem der Meinung in diesem Fall die passenste Antwort gegeben zu haben.
Eine Schande ist das.
(Nicht bös gemeint...)
1. Es gibt keinen reinen Unix-Kernel.
Das ist ja der wesentliche Unterschied zw. klassischen Unices und Linux.
Bei Linux kannste den Kernel, die C-Library (meistens glibc) und das Userland
auswechseln und kombinieren wie deine Garderobe.*
* ich übertreibe ein wenig. Die Kernel-Module müssen natürlich immer zum Kernel passen und manche Programme müssten neukompiliert werden gegen neue Kernel-sourcen oder glibc, um einwandfrei weiterzufunktionieren.
Klassische Unix Betriebssysteme bieten diesen "Luxus" nicht, den Kernel vom Rest des Systems so schön trennen zu können, wie es Linux kann.
2. Jedes Open-Source Unix/BSD hat seine kompletten Quellen online,
du musst dich nur auf den jeweiligen Seiten umgucken.
OFFTOPIC:
3. Also von unixboard-Benutzern hätte ich mehr und bessere Antworten auf diese Frage erwartet.
PS: Ich bin Linux-Spezialist, von BSDs/Unixen weiss ich nur wenig und bin trotzdem der Meinung in diesem Fall die passenste Antwort gegeben zu haben.
Eine Schande ist das.
(Nicht bös gemeint...)